On Jun 9, 2017, malaki wrote: I'm trying to get up the nerve to start a post/thread asking what people want to have made. I do a lot of computer work, fixing, repairing and programming in the Java, C, and .NET worlds. Lately I've been working on tying tiny MCU (micro-controller) devices to larger PCs via wireless or serial. I think small MCUs are MADE for magic effects, as they are self-contained and really, really small. An MCU as big as a coin cell battery can run on that battery-and even be wireless! I've had about a dozen loose/fuzzy ideas in mind with geared down (30rpm) mini-motors and servos to achieve close-up illusions, but I want to make something someone can actually use. So I want to solicit ideas for what could be of real use, make one, and see if they like it. In that sense, I'm l;ooking for partners who know the effect, and I will make the method. So can you share what kinds of devices (large or small) you have envisioned that need to come into the world as a prototype? If you wish, I'm open to PMs. That goes for any-/everyone else! Quote:
One device that I have contemplated over the years is a Cup & Ball table that used a carousel under the table that could be indexed to align with black art holes in the table. A small elevator device could bring about some amazing productions/transformations. I am keenly interested in what you envision the spectator experience to be. I'm truly a solver/creator, with only about 30% imagination! One idea I have is modeled after Fred Kaps' 'floating wine cork' in a box. He had a typical filament from a ring, and it was sold commercially. Instead of this static version, I'm thinking of mono-filament to a card via ortho/magician's wax, spinning in 'mid air', but slowly (~30rpm, for example). The speed could be adjusted based on light, sound, even remote... The card is easily removed for a souvenir (as Fed did with the cork), or used as a way to show their selected card, or... For all I know, it might look goofy. The concept is centered around the effect changing with no physical motion of the performer. You know, the other hand tugging up & down, and no threads attached to walls, etc....impromptu/do-anywhere effects. What are your thoughts?
